Technical Specifications
| Specification | Details |
|---|
| Model | Bently Nevada 3500/32M 149986-02 + 125720-01 |
| Type | Relay Control Module + Output Module |
| Dimensions | 241 x 24.4 x 242 mm |
| Weight | 0.7 kg |
| Power Supply | 24V DC (Nominal) |
| Control Channels | 4 Channels |
| Relay Type | SPDT (Single-Pole Double-Throw) |
| Relay Switching Capacity | 1 A @ 30V DC / 0.5 A @ 125V AC |
| Operating Temperature Range | -20°C to 60°C |
| Storage Temperature Range | -40°C to 85°C |
| Mounting Type | Rack or Panel Mounting |
| Certifications | CE, UL, RoHS |
